How they compare
Mali currently reports 60.0% against 59.3% in Liberia, a difference of 0.7%.
Across all 6 years both countries report, Mali has been ahead every year.
Liberia ranks 139th and Mali ranks 137th of 185 countries.
Mali has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Liberia | Mali |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 58.1% | 63.3% | 5.2% | Mali |
| 2010s | 63.6% | 70.1% | 6.5% | Mali |
| 2020s | 61.2% | 62.1% | 1.0% | Mali |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Number of male deaths ages 60+ due to non-communicable diseases divided by number of all male deaths ages 60+, expressed by percentage. Non-Communicable diseases include cancer, diabetes mellitus, cardiovascular diseases, digestive diseases, skin diseases, musculoskeletal diseases, and congenital anomalies.
